Baldwin, MD – Dr. Marilyn Maze is a principal partner of PsyCoun Institute, which offers training related to psychology, counseling, and career development to counselors, social workers, and other mental health professionals.

PsyCoun Institute provides in-service training to counselors who want to improve and expand their skills to be more effective.

“It’s very important to me to stay connected with as many different types of counselors as possible because we all work together. We need each other,” says Dr. Maze.

PsyCoun works closely with school counselors, specifically in the area of Lauren’s Law, which deals with teen suicide.

Dr. Maze is a highly-experienced presenter and developer of training materials with experience in education, non-profit, and for-profit environments.

Dr. Maze has been helping individuals as a career counselor since 1975. One of the topics she is focused on is future jobs: understanding how work is changing and what that means for the people making career plans today.

Since 2012, Dr. Maze has served as executive director of the Asia Pacific Career Development Association.

“One of the topics I give talks on is career planning around the world, knowing how our work differs in other countries is helpful to those of us in the field,” says Dr. Maze. “I am very excited about the growth of career planning in the Asia Pacific region. Asia is really vibrant and each country has similar problems when it comes to career counseling. So, we get together and share, and each person at our conference is from a different country.”
